Analysis

Paraguay recorded 16.7% for benefits incidence in 2nd quintile (%) - domestic private transfers in 2022.

The figure is down 3.7% on the previous year and up 29.8% over ten years.

Over the whole period, benefits incidence in 2nd quintile (%) - domestic private transfers in Paraguay peaked at 21.2% in 2013 and was at its lowest, 10.7%, in 2008.

That places Paraguay 8th out of 30 countries with data for 2022, putting it in the top qu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 16 years of available data.

Benefits incidence in 2nd quintile (%) - Domestic Private Transfers in Paraguay, year by year

Annual values for Benefits incidence in 2nd quintile (%) - Domestic Private Transfers -rural in Paraguay, 2007 to 2022.
Year Value Change
2007 11.5%
2008 10.7% -6.8%
2009 15.7% +46.4%
2010 14.4% -8.2%
2011 12.2% -15.4%
2012 12.9% +5.5%
2013 21.2% +65.2%
2014 16.0% -24.6%
2015 16.1% +0.4%
2016 16.4% +2.0%
2017 18.4% +12.0%
2018 16.6% -9.7%
2019 16.1% -3.0%
2020 16.6% +3.0%
2021 17.3% +4.7%
2022 16.7% -3.7%
